1972 MG Midget/Dragonfly Roadster

Was the running gear built from MGB parts? Was it a kit? Very nice looking car. PJ
 
It was actually based on the MG Midget and Austin Healey Sprite. The front fenders and valence were unbolted and the subframe lengthened by about a foot and reinforced. The rear body section was also replaced with a shortened fiberglass unit. Its powered by either an A-series or a 1500 spitfire/midget engine depending on the year the donor car was built.
